On symplectic self-adjointness of Hamiltonian operator matrices
Abstract
Symplectic self-adjointness of Hamiltonian operator matrices is studied, which arises in symplectic elasticity and optimal control. For the cases of diagonal domain and off-diagonal domain, necessary and sufficient conditions are shown. The proofs use Frobenius-Schur fractorizations of unbounded operator matrices. Under additional assumptions, sufficient conditions based on perturbation method are obtained. The theory is applied to a problem in symplectic elasticity.
